Well, not power related but I just a complete brake overhaul today on my '97 GP and thats making me grin. The old pads and rotors were shot and the fluid was green, and they had very bad pulsation. Installed new brembo oem replacement rotors, hawk ceramic performance pads, goodridge stainless steel braided lines, and flushed the system with valvoline synthetic dot4 fluid. They stop better than new now. Quiet and smooth, and I barely have to press the pedal to come to a stop. :)

with those mods, you'd have even better results if you get it tuned. Contact Mark from MP Racing, (lvemy3100) he lives up in Antioch IL, I know you're kinda far, but maybe he can meet you. He'll retune you're temp setting for the fan turn on to match you're 180* stat and redo the shift points on your trans and since you got headers and P&P heads, adjust fuel trims to compensate the better flow for more power.
He tuned mine, and my car has more power and i"m still getting about 20-22 mpg city, if I really lay on in around 18mpg. (with current gas prices, that's something to consider)
